mirror of
https://github.com/fosslinux/live-bootstrap.git
synced 2026-03-18 17:25:24 +01:00
Merge pull request #494 from fosslinux/cd-helpers-sh
Handle files correctly that start with a dash
This commit is contained in:
commit
0fa2f1e5ed
1 changed files with 5 additions and 5 deletions
|
|
@ -31,8 +31,8 @@ _get_files() {
|
||||||
for f in ${fs}; do
|
for f in ${fs}; do
|
||||||
# Archive symlinks to directories as symlinks
|
# Archive symlinks to directories as symlinks
|
||||||
echo "${prefix}/${f}"
|
echo "${prefix}/${f}"
|
||||||
if [ -d "${f}" ] && ! [ -h "${f}" ]; then
|
if [ -d "./${f}" ] && ! [ -h "./${f}" ]; then
|
||||||
cd "${f}"
|
cd "./${f}"
|
||||||
_get_files "${prefix}/${f}"
|
_get_files "${prefix}/${f}"
|
||||||
cd ..
|
cd ..
|
||||||
fi
|
fi
|
||||||
|
|
@ -54,9 +54,9 @@ reset_timestamp() {
|
||||||
fs="${fs} $(echo .[0-z]*)"
|
fs="${fs} $(echo .[0-z]*)"
|
||||||
fi
|
fi
|
||||||
for f in ${fs}; do
|
for f in ${fs}; do
|
||||||
touch -h -t 197001010000.00 "${f}"
|
touch -h -t 197001010000.00 "./${f}"
|
||||||
if [ -d "${f}" ]; then
|
if [ -d "./${f}" ]; then
|
||||||
cd "${f}"
|
cd "./${f}"
|
||||||
reset_timestamp
|
reset_timestamp
|
||||||
cd ..
|
cd ..
|
||||||
fi
|
fi
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ue